版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2025年中职(软件与信息服务)软件需求分析阶段测试试题及答案
(考试时间:90分钟满分100分)班级______姓名______第I卷(选择题共40分)本卷共20小题,每小题2分。在每小题给出的四个选项中,只有一项是符合题目要求的。1.软件需求分析的主要任务不包括以下哪项?A.确定软件系统的功能需求B.确定软件系统的性能需求C.确定软件系统的开发成本D.确定软件系统的运行环境需求2.以下哪种需求获取方法适用于获取用户对软件功能的直观感受?A.问卷调查B.面谈C.观察用户工作流程D.文档分析3.软件需求规格说明书的作用不包括?A.作为软件开发人员进行设计和编码的依据B.作为软件测试人员进行测试的依据C.作为用户验收软件的依据D.作为项目管理的唯一依据4.以下关于功能性需求的描述,错误的是?A.功能性需求定义了软件系统必须完成的任务B.功能性需求通常用“做什么”来描述C.功能性需求不包括系统的性能要求D.功能性需求是软件需求的重要组成部分5.非功能性需求不包括以下哪方面?A.可靠性B.易用性C.功能模块划分D.可维护性6.软件需求分析过程中,对需求进行优先级排序的目的是?A.方便开发人员按照顺序开发B.帮助项目团队确定哪些需求最重要,优先实现C.使需求文档看起来更有条理D.满足所有用户的需求7.以下哪种情况最有可能导致软件需求变更?A.用户对业务流程的理解发生变化B.开发团队技术能力提升C.项目预算增加D.软件测试结果良好8.在需求分析阶段,对软件系统进行可行性研究的主要内容不包括?A.技术可行性B.经济可行性C.操作可行性D.美观可行性9.需求分析阶段产生的文档不包括?A.需求规格说明书B.项目开发计划C.可行性研究报告D.测试用例文档10.以下关于用户需求和软件需求的关系,正确的是?A.用户需求等同于软件需求B.软件需求是对用户需求的提炼和细化C.用户需求不需要考虑技术实现,软件需求需要D.软件需求只关注功能需求,用户需求包含更多方面11.软件需求分析中的“用例”是指?A.用户使用软件的具体场景B.软件系统的功能模块C.软件开发过程中的一个步骤D.测试软件的一种方法12.需求分析阶段与用户沟通时,以下哪种做法不利于获取准确需求?A.积极倾听用户意见B.引导用户表达需求C.与用户争论需求的合理性D.对用户需求进行记录和确认13.对于一个电商系统,“用户能够方便地查询商品信息”属于?A.功能性需求B.非功能性需求C.性能需求D.安全需求14.软件需求分析中,对需求进行验证的目的是?A.确保需求的完整性B.确保需求的一致性C.确保需求的可行性D.以上都是15.以下哪种需求分析方法强调从用户的角度出发,模拟用户在实际场景中的操作?A.面向数据流的结构化分析方法B.面向对象的分析方法C.基于场景的分析方法D.原型法16.在软件需求规格说明书中,对功能需求的描述通常采用?A.自然语言B.伪代码C.图形化表示D.以上都可以17.软件需求分析阶段,对软件系统的性能需求不包括?A.响应时间B.吞吐量C.数据准确性D.可扩展性18.需求分析过程中,发现需求存在冲突时,应该?A.按照开发团队的意见处理B.由项目经理决定如何处理C.与相关人员沟通协商,解决冲突D.暂时搁置冲突,继续开发19.对于一个在线教育系统,“系统能够在1秒内响应用户的登录请求”属于?A.功能性需求B.非功能性需求C.业务需求D.市场需求20.软件需求分析的最终目标是?A.编写完整的需求文档B.确定软件系统的所有需求C.确保软件系统满足用户需求,具有良好的质量D.完成软件系统的设计第II卷(非选择题共60分)21.(10分)请简要阐述软件需求分析的重要性。22.(10分)简述获取软件需求的常见方法及其优缺点。23.(10分)在软件需求规格说明书中,应包含哪些主要内容?24.(15分)阅读以下材料:某公司计划开发一款在线办公软件,方便员工在不同地点进行协同办公。目前已经收集了部分用户需求:员工可以在线创建、编辑和共享文档;能够实时进行视频会议;可以方便地管理任务进度。问题:请根据上述需求,分析该软件的功能性需求和非功能性需求(至少各列出两条)。25.(15分)阅读以下材料:某电商平台在需求分析阶段,发现不同用户对商品搜索功能有不同需求。部分用户希望搜索结果能按照价格从低到高排序,部分用户希望按照销量排序,还有部分用户希望能同时看到多种排序方式。问题:针对该情况,你认为在需求分析过程中应如何处理这些需求冲突?答案:1.C2.C3.D4.C5.C6.B7.A8.D9.D10.B11.A12.C13.A14.D15.C16.A17.C18.C19.B20.C21.软件需求分析是软件开发过程中的关键环节。它为后续的设计、编码、测试等阶段提供了准确的依据,确保软件系统满足用户实际需求。通过需求分析,可以明确软件功能、性能等各方面要求,避免开发过程中的盲目性,提高软件质量,降低开发成本和维护成本,增强软件的可靠性和用户满意度。22.问卷调查:优点是能快速收集大量用户意见,覆盖面广;缺点是用户可能不认真填写,难以深入了解需求。面谈:优点是可直接交流,获取详细准确信息;缺点是耗费时间精力,可能受沟通能力影响。观察用户工作流程:优点是直观真实;缺点是可能遗漏一些潜在需求。文档分析:优点是利用现有资料,节省时间;缺点是文档可能不准确或不完整且可能过时。23.应包含引言,介绍项目背景等;总体描述,说明软件目标等;详细需求,包括功能需求、性能需求、数据需求等;运行环境需求;其他需求,如安全性、可维护性等;附录,如有补充信息。24.功能性需求:员工可在线创建、编辑和共享文档;能实时进行视频会议;方便地管理任务进度。非功能性需求:软件响应速度快,确保视频会议流畅;数据安全性高,保护员工文档和任务信息;具备良好的兼容性,能在多种设备上使用。25.首先,与相关用户群体进一步沟通,了解他们对不同排序方式的具体需求和使用场景
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025年中职会计学(会计教育心理学)试题及答案
- 2025年中职(动物繁殖技术)畜禽人工授精实操阶段测试题及答案
- 2025年大学智能设备运行与维护(智能系统调试)试题及答案
- 2025年大学美术(美术批评)试题及答案
- 2025年高职(应用化工技术)应用化工进阶阶段测试试题及答案
- 2025年中职网络技术(网络设备进阶调试)试题及答案
- 2025年高职第四学年(工程造价咨询)咨询实务阶段测试题及答案
- 2025年中职民俗学(民俗学概论)试题及答案
- 2025年高职铁道运输(铁路客运调度)试题及答案
- 2025年高职电力工程及自动化(供配电系统)试题及答案
- 中药热熨敷技术及操作流程图
- 鹤壁供热管理办法
- 01 华为采购管理架构(20P)
- 糖尿病逆转与综合管理案例分享
- 工行信息安全管理办法
- 娱乐场所安全管理规定与措施
- 化学●广西卷丨2024年广西普通高中学业水平选择性考试高考化学真题试卷及答案
- 人卫基础护理学第七版试题及答案
- 烟草物流寄递管理制度
- 被打和解协议书范本
- 《糖尿病合并高血压患者管理指南(2025版)》解读
评论
0/150
提交评论